#### Fan-out backpressure: quick fix

If your plugin's notification queue on Chirpline backs up, the dispatcher starts shedding low-priority events — don't panic, that's by design. Throttle your emit rate to under 50/sec and drain the backlog table manually if needed. To inspect backlog depth yourself, connect to the staging queue store with this string.

primary connection of yagep-kahip = redis://giliel_svc:zYiKsLL2PLpfPL@db-348f.xolmarsys.corp:5432/fenwyn

Finance Review Summary — Inventory Write-Down

For heads of department: the review confirms a write-down against the Perivale component stock, reflecting obsolescence identified during the autumn audit. Provisions have been adjusted, and carrying values now align with net realisable estimates. No further impairments are anticipated this period. The confidential annotation below indicates the strategic implications for planning.

internal memo for kagaf-yajog: The western region missed its Kasvan quota by 63.4 percent last quarter. Casethox Holdings plans to raise the Lamvan list price by 43.5 percent in January. The finance team signed off on a budget of $404.3 million for Project Fraius. The renewal with Fenionox Freight closes at $155.2 million a year, 29.1 percent above the last contract.

Migration step 4 — ChipGate reader service. Before moving the ChipGate timing-chip reader off the old Harrowfield host, stop the ingest daemon and confirm the mat controllers have drained their buffers; partial reads during a race replay will corrupt split times. Copy the calibration archive across first, then install the 3.x package on the new node. Do not start the service until you have verified the antenna map matches the Lakemont course layout. Once that checks out, apply the configuration below exactly as written.

settings of tagef-bawif:
DRUIX_HOST=druix.zemvarlabs.internal
DRUIX_PORT=8000

Subject: Canary gating cut-over summary

Hi Marisol,

The new canary deploy gating rules went live on Driftgate at 09:00. Releases now require two consecutive healthy evaluation windows, and error-rate thresholds are compared against the stable cohort rather than absolute values. One rollback fired during soak — expected behaviour, confirmed benign. The gating controller was restarted with the configuration values below.

settings of bawif-fawif:
ralix:
  log_level: warn
  metrics_host: metrics.ralix.tolvaqsys.internal
  pool_size: 32